Joy, Starting, I think with PS6, you have the ability to use custom shapes (1) , they are limited by paths/vectors and are therefore very crisp. They can delimit adjustment layers, etc...
You see that you have vector data with the vertical line in the layers palette (2)
Vector layers is an abuse of language, sorry for the confusion, as I'm sure you know this already!

Joy, think along the lines of a mask on a layer, but using a vector path to define and manipulate the mask instead of painting pixels on the greyscale image.
You do not have partial transparency, it is a definite see / no see.

This should give you an idea about channels.
A mask is just another channel. Look in the Channel palette when you add a mask. That's where it lives, not bothering anyone.

Instead of defining where the RGB goes, a mask channel defines the transparency / opacity. (But you already knew that! )
